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23 666823 952985792 56560597988
632288 66 48661
632288 66 48661
2331610699 79 26 83798070
All about undefined
Interested in learning more?
632288 66 48661
2331610699 79 26 83798070
See more
4912893 79064
07196 2088076 71 8778996769
See more
1863653 59 370
257561 153 08 11823094
See more